In today's games, people are aware that players have HUGE opening ranges on the button, and in general button raises get a ton less respect than they did a year or two ago. People are constantly defending their blinds from habitual stealers, so I don't think raising the button light all the time is a great idea for most players unless you're comfortable / profitable defending your button steals from 3 bets from the blinds.

Also, having a tight range in early position is completely overrated, and in my opinion a mistake for players who play well postflop.

first point: i think it's fairly rare at 1/2 to find players who will 3bet from the blinds often enough to make abusing the button -ev. but yeah, against some of these guys, calling 3bets in position with a plan to take away the pot is a great play.

second point: as my postflop play improves, i'm beginning to grasp the extent to which this is true. of course, this is largely dependent on the villains you're sitting with. my utg vpip has jumped from about 11 to almost 20 of late.

if someone 3 bets your button open over zero limpers one in 3 times, even if you fold every time they three bet you're breaking even. if they do it less often you're making money from taking their blinds and if they do it more often than 33% of your button opens then you will destroy them.
